记得上下班打卡 | git大法好,push需谨慎

Commit 8abaad3e authored by 胡佳晨's avatar 胡佳晨

Merge remote-tracking branch 'origin/dev' into dev

parents 74b5e1e2 9d05a3d5
......@@ -10,7 +10,7 @@ import java.util.List;
/**
* 会员信息
*/
public interface IAdamMemberService extends IService<AdamMember> {
public interface IAdamMemberAdminService extends IService<AdamMember> {
List<AdamMember> list();
......
......@@ -6,6 +6,7 @@ import lombok.Data;
import lombok.EqualsAndHashCode;
import java.io.Serializable;
import java.time.LocalDateTime;
/**
* 会员信息
......@@ -103,4 +104,8 @@ public class AdamMember implements Serializable {
* 限购数量
*/
private Integer limitation;
private LocalDateTime createdAt;
private LocalDateTime updatedAt;
}
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d">
<mapper namespace="com.liquidnet.service.adam.mapper.AdamMemberPriceMapper">
<mapper namespace="com.liquidnet.service.adam.mapper.AdamMemberMapper">
<resultMap id="MemberResult" type="com.liquidnet.service.adam.entity.AdamMember">
<result column="member_id" property="memberId" />
<result column="status" property="status" />
<result column="name" property="name" />
<result column="title" property="title" />
<result column="sub_title" property="subTitle" />
......@@ -27,7 +26,6 @@
<!-- sql -->
<sql id="Base_Column">
m.member_id,
m.status,
m.name,
m.title,
m.sub_title,
......@@ -49,7 +47,7 @@
</sql>
<select id="getFirstMember" parameterType="java.lang.String" resultMap="MemberResult">
SELECT
<include refid="Base_Column"></include>
*
FROM adam_member_price as m
limit 0,1
</select>
......
......@@ -5,7 +5,7 @@ import com.liquidnet.commons.lang.util.IDGenerator;
import com.liquidnet.service.ResponseDto;
import com.liquidnet.service.adam.dto.AdamMemberParam;
import com.liquidnet.service.adam.entity.AdamMember;
import com.liquidnet.service.adam.service.admin.IAdamMemberService;
import com.liquidnet.service.adam.service.admin.IAdamMemberAdminService;
import io.swagger.annotations.Api;
import io.swagger.annotations.ApiOperation;
import lombok.extern.slf4j.Slf4j;
......@@ -17,11 +17,11 @@ import org.springframework.web.bind.annotation.*;
@Api(tags = "会员信息")
@Slf4j
@RestController
@RequestMapping("/member")
public class AdamMemberController {
@RequestMapping("/admin/member")
public class AdamMemberAdminController {
@Autowired
IAdamMemberService adamMemberService;
IAdamMemberAdminService adamMemberService;
@Autowired
AmqpTemplate amqpTemplate;
......
......@@ -62,7 +62,9 @@ public class AdamMemberServiceImpl extends ServiceImpl<AdamMemberMapper, AdamMem
memberPrice = mongoTemplate.find(Query.query(Criteria.where("memberId").is(memberId)),
AdamMemberPriceVo.class, AdamMemberPriceVo.class.getSimpleName());
}
info.setAdamMemberPrice(memberPrice);
if (memberPrice.size() > 0) {
info.setAdamMemberPrice(memberPrice);
}
return info;
}
......
......@@ -12,7 +12,7 @@ import com.liquidnet.service.adam.entity.AdamMember;
import com.liquidnet.service.adam.entity.AdamMemberPrice;
import com.liquidnet.service.adam.mapper.AdamMemberMapper;
import com.liquidnet.service.adam.mapper.AdamMemberPriceMapper;
import com.liquidnet.service.adam.service.admin.IAdamMemberService;
import com.liquidnet.service.adam.service.admin.IAdamMemberAdminService;
import com.mongodb.BasicDBObject;
import lombok.extern.slf4j.Slf4j;
import org.springframework.amqp.rabbit.core.RabbitTemplate;
......@@ -29,7 +29,7 @@ import java.util.*;
@Slf4j
@Service
public class AdamMemberServiceImpl extends ServiceImpl<AdamMemberMapper, AdamMember> implements IAdamMemberService {
public class AdamMemberServiceAdminImpl extends ServiceImpl<AdamMemberMapper, AdamMember> implements IAdamMemberAdminService {
@Autowired
AdamMemberMapper adamMemberMapper;
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ment